And here's one to avoid: Lessno.com. They advertised a fare about $100 less than anything else I could find from Greensboro (those of us here usually have to drive 2 hrs. to Charlotte for good fares). I gave my cc info, they sent a confirmation, and said e-tickets would arrive within 48 hours. They didn't. I called, and they said, Sorry, the airline changed that flight and we didn't want to book it without talking to you first. They said the return flight now left hours later, and the connecting flight to Greensboro would arrive the next morning, which was unacceptable, of course. But the airline didn't change the flight; it was (and is) still available, it just has gone up $100 or so. I'm not sure it was ever available for the price I was given. In othe words, Lessno wouldn't stand behind the price they gave. I've canceled, and I hope they fold like a cheap map.

We have used US Airways out of Toronto in the past. I just did a quick check and for next May it is $557(USD) from Toronto and $592(USD) from Buffalo.

That fare is about the same price we would have paid for our trip May 07, but we flew Air Canada from Toronto to Ft Lauderdale, then Spirit to St Thomas. We liked staying overnight in Lauderdale so plan to do it again May 08. The Air Canada, Spirit flights will be $644 (CAD). These prices are all per person.
